Mississippi Sin Dip
Indulge in a sinfully delicious appetizer with this savory Mississippi Sin Dip recipe. Perfect for gatherings or just a cozy night in, this dip combines creamy goodness with a kick of spice that will have your taste buds begging for more.
Ingredients:
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ened
- 1 cup sour cream
- 2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
- 1/2 cup diced ham
- 1/4 cup chopped green onions
- 1/4 cup diced jalapenos
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p onion powder
- 1/2 tsp paprika
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
- 1 loaf French bread, hollowed out for serving
Instructions:
- Preheat oven to 350°F.
- In a mixing bowl, combine cream cheese, sour cream, cheddar cheese, ham, green onions, jalapenos, gar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, salt, and black pepper.
- Mix until well combined.
- Spoon the mixture into the hollowed-out bread loaf.
- Wrap the loaf in foil and bake for 25-30 minutes, until hot and bubbly.
- Serve hot with bread cubes, crackers, or veggies for dipping.

Helpful tips:
- For an extra kick of heat, add additional diced jalapenos or a pinch of cayenne pepper.
- Top the dip with extra shredded cheese before baking for a gooey, cheesy crust.
Expert Secrets:
- Allow the cream cheese to come to room temperature before mixing for a smoother consistency.
- Adjust the amount of jalapenos based on your desired level of spiciness.
